SOFTUBE Statement Lead

With its long history of modelling professional gear, Swedish firm Softube has serious industry form for bringing the vintage stock of companies such as Tube-Tech, Solid State Logic, Weiss Engineering and Trident to the desktops of today’s music-makers in sublime software shells. With its latest release, the company presents Statement Lead, a state-of-the-art user-friendly polyphonic synth that Softube claims has the contemporary producer and songwriter in mind. Given Softube’s recent releases, our excitement levels have been through the roof waiting for this to arrive, and we’ve been itching to see whether it can maintain such high standards
